■ Connect the headset
A compatible headset may be included with your
device or purchased separately as an
enhancement. (See "Enhancements," page 71.)
1. Plug the headset connector into the
Pop-Port™ connector at the bottom end of
your device.
2. Position the headset on your ear.
With the headset connected, you can make,
answer, and end calls as usual.
• Use the keypad to enter numbers.
• Press the call key to place a call.
• Press the end key to end a call.
■ Change Xpress-on™ covers
Before removing the cover, always switch off the power and disconnect the
charger and any other device. Avoid touching electronic components while
changing the covers. Always store and use the device with the covers attached.
Remove the back cover and the battery
See "Remove the back cover," page 14 and "Remove the battery," page 14 for
instructions on removing the back cover and the battery.
Remove the front cover
Gently pull the bottom of the front cover
away from the rest of the device, and
remove the front cover.
